]> git.apps.os.sepia.ceph.com Git - ceph-ansible.git/commitdiff
ceph-osd: do not relabel /run/udev in containerized context
authorGuillaume Abrioux <gabrioux@redhat.com>
Mon, 3 Jun 2019 17:15:30 +0000 (19:15 +0200)
committerDimitri Savineau <savineau.dimitri@gmail.com>
Tue, 4 Jun 2019 15:32:41 +0000 (11:32 -0400)
Otherwise content in /run/udev is mislabeled and prevent some services
like NetworkManager from starting.

Signed-off-by: Guillaume Abrioux <gabrioux@redhat.com>
roles/ceph-osd/templates/ceph-osd-run.sh.j2

index ba2acf817b77d1751e80a56455c3b19f87dc7c3e..755093b495c43a868d5ebcc1173ed2c53220618f 100644 (file)
@@ -36,7 +36,7 @@ numactl \
   -v /var/lib/ceph:/var/lib/ceph:z \
   -v /etc/ceph:/etc/ceph:z \
   -v /var/run/ceph:/var/run/ceph:z \
-  -v /var/run/udev/:/var/run/udev/:z \
+  -v /var/run/udev/:/var/run/udev/ \
   {% if ansible_distribution == 'Ubuntu' -%}
   --security-opt apparmor:unconfined \
   {% endif -%}